166627 2003-08-10 13:12:00 hi im running win xp profesional a via p4pb 400fl motherboard 512 meg of 333ddr ram and a geforce 4 mx graphics card
the comp shuts down to a blue screen sometimes a couple of times a day mainly when im on line sometimes it will work fine for several days message when blue screen comes up says the comp has been shut down to protect it with the following reasons for the shut down what do they mean how do i fix

win 32k.sys address Bf86d379 base at Bf800000 or
win 32k .sys.address bf878b6a base at bf800000 had one that said

ntfs.sys address f8401bc6 base at f83e6000

any ideas or help appreciated

166628 2003-08-10 16:40:00 Well I just have one idea at this point.

What you posted indicates a sick memory stick to me.

Try a search on Google for Memtest86 and download. Make sure you have a formatted floppy disk handy and extract the memtest to the floppy using make.

Boot off the newly made floppy.

You may need to get into the BIOS first and use Floppy as first BOOT device, HDD0 or HDD1 as second boot device. Use CDRom as third boot device.

If you need more help about getting into the BIOS then post back here. Usually hitting the <Del> key at start does it... It could be other keys like F10 etc.

Post back with your motherboard info if you know and I'm sure that someone will help you on how to get into the BIOS. Just change the BOOT order and nothing else in the BIOS!!
